export declare function printAndExit(message: string, code?: number): never; /** * Tokenizes the arguments string into an array of strings, supporting quoted * values and escaped characters. * Converted from: https://github.com/nodejs/node/blob/c29d53c5cfc63c5a876084e788d70c9e87bed880/src/node_options.cc#L1401 * * @param input The arguments string to be tokenized. * @returns An array of strings with the tokenized arguments. */ export declare const tokenizeArgs: (input: string) => string[]; /** * The debug address is in the form of `[host:]port`. The host is optional. */ type DebugAddress = { host: string | undefined; port: number; }; /** * Formats the debug address into a string. */ export declare const formatDebugAddress: ({ host, port }: DebugAddress) => string; /** * Get's the debug address from the `NODE_OPTIONS` environment variable. If the * address is not found, it returns the default host (`undefined`) and port * (`9229`). * * @returns An object with the host and port of the debug address. */ export declare const getParsedDebugAddress: () => DebugAddress; /** * Get the debug address from the `NODE_OPTIONS` environment variable and format * it into a string. * * @returns A string with the formatted debug address. */ export declare const getFormattedDebugAddress: () => string; /** * Stringify the arguments to be used in a command line. It will ignore any * argument that has a value of `undefined`. * * @param args The arguments to be stringified. * @returns A string with the arguments. */ export declare function formatNodeOptions(args: Record<string, string | boolean | undefined>): string; /** * Get the node options from the `NODE_OPTIONS` environment variable and parse * them into an object without the inspect options. * * @returns An object with the parsed node options. */ export declare function getParsedNodeOptionsWithoutInspect(): { [longOption: string]: string | boolean | undefined; }; /** * Get the node options from the `NODE_OPTIONS` environment variable and format * them into a string without the inspect options. * * @returns A string with the formatted node options. */ export declare function getFormattedNodeOptionsWithoutInspect(): string; /** * Check if the value is a valid positive integer and parse it. If it's not, it will throw an error. * * @param value The value to be parsed. */ export declare function parseValidPositiveInteger(value: string): number; export declare const RESTART_EXIT_CODE = 77; export type NodeInspectType = 'inspect' | 'inspect-brk' | undefined; /** * Get the debug type from the `NODE_OPTIONS` environment variable. */ export declare function getNodeDebugType(): NodeInspectType; /** * Get the `max-old-space-size` value from the `NODE_OPTIONS` environment * variable. * * @returns The value of the `max-old-space-size` option as a number. */ export declare function getMaxOldSpaceSize(): number | undefined; export {};
